A simple question, what is a website? In the bare form, a site is an individual domain name that contains different web pages. We should all know that by now, but surprisingly what we should avoid all know, is the advantages a site provides for your business and its stunning to witness how many business don't actually have a site or online existence!

 

If you have a company and don't have a website, you are dropping out on great opportunities for your business. A website itself can be used to accomplish many different marketing strategies to help your business expand.

 

As being a business owner, you need to know where your consumers are. But what if consumers know your business and what you can offer, nevertheless they won't be able to reach you? That is certainly one of the risks you take by not having a site for your business.

Accessible around the clock

Your web site and social media accounts are accessible 24/7/365. Suppose you want to buy from a shop. You put in all the effort necessary to go to the store, but when you make it happen, it can close. We all know how irate we feel in this situation. You'll think twice about returning given the bad taste it is left (ok might have been your fault for not checking but whats up, this is proving the point here! ). You are going to just find another store that is more easily accessible.

 

As your website is operational 24 as well as 7, from the convenience of the neighborhood coffee shop, their couch or their bed, your customers and clients can certainly access your website and services.

Credibility

By building a site you are giving your business the possibility to inform consumers why they should trust you and the testimonials and facts to back up those opportunities. Believe it or not, most people will search the internet for a product or service before the purchase to evaluate the credibility first. At the time you provide good service or product, positive word-of-mouth about your business will probably spread. This usually in turn, offers more repeat and new business.

 

People tend to trust a business once they have done business with it. Using your website, you can continually serve consumers on the web and increase your reliability as the owner of a business.
